Enter your email address below and subscribe to our newsletter

How to Use Claude Code for Web Development (Complete Guide)




⚠ Duplicate check: This draft looks similar to an existing post (semantic match, 81% similarity) — Best practices for Claude Code. Decide to merge, rewrite angle, or publish as follow-up before going live.

Web development has undergone a significant transformation with the advent of AI-powered tools like Claude Code. This versatile platform offers a wide range of features that cater to various stages of the web development process, from project setup to deployment. By leveraging Claude Code's capabilities, developers can streamline their workflow, boost productivity, and deliver higher-quality projects. In this comprehensive guide, we'll delve into the world of Claude Code for web development, exploring its key features, project setup, multi-file editing, debugging, deployment, and advanced workflow patterns. Whether you're a seasoned developer or just starting out, this article will provide you with the insights and practical tips necessary to maximize your productivity and efficiency with Claude Code.

Project Setup and Initialization

Claude Code is designed to be user-friendly and accessible, even for developers with limited experience in AI-powered tools. To get started, you'll need to create a new project in the Claude Code dashboard. This involves selecting a project type (e.g., web development, mobile app development), choosing a template, and setting up the necessary dependencies. Claude Code provides a range of project templates, including popular frameworks like React and Angular. You can also import existing projects or start from scratch. Once your project is set up, you'll have access to a comprehensive dashboard that allows you to manage your project files, dependencies, and settings.

One of the standout features of Claude Code is its ability to handle multi-file projects with ease. You can create, edit, and manage multiple files within a single project, eliminating the need to switch between different IDEs or text editors. This feature is particularly useful for large-scale projects that involve multiple developers and intricate file structures.

When setting up a new project, it's essential to configure the necessary dependencies and settings. Claude Code allows you to install packages, configure build tools, and set up debugging tools, all within the dashboard. This streamlines the development process and reduces the risk of errors.

Multi-File Editing and Collaboration

Multi-file editing is a critical feature in Claude Code, allowing developers to work on complex projects with ease. You can create, edit, and manage multiple files within a single project, using the built-in code editor or integrating your preferred IDE. Claude Code also supports real-time collaboration, enabling multiple developers to work on the same project simultaneously. This feature is particularly useful for distributed teams or projects with multiple stakeholders.

When working on multi-file projects, Claude Code provides a range of features that enhance productivity and collaboration. These include live previews, code suggestions, and real-time feedback. Additionally, you can use the built-in version control system to manage changes, track progress, and collaborate with team members.

One of the key benefits of Claude Code's multi-file editing feature is its ability to handle complex file structures with ease. You can navigate through your project files, create new files, and edit existing ones, all within the dashboard. This eliminates the need to switch between different IDEs or text editors, reducing the risk of errors and increasing productivity.

Debugging and Testing

Debugging and testing are critical stages in the web development process, and Claude Code provides a range of features to support these tasks. You can use the built-in debugging tools to identify and fix errors, as well as test your code in real-time. Claude Code also supports unit testing, integration testing, and end-to-end testing, enabling you to ensure your code meets the highest standards of quality and reliability.

When debugging your code, Claude Code provides a range of features that enhance productivity and efficiency. These include live code analysis, error detection, and code suggestions. Additionally, you can use the built-in version control system to track changes and collaborate with team members.

One of the key benefits of Claude Code's debugging feature is its ability to identify and fix errors quickly and efficiently. You can use the built-in debugging tools to pinpoint errors, track changes, and collaborate with team members, reducing the risk of errors and increasing productivity.

Deployment and Hosting

Once your project is complete, it's time to deploy it to a hosting platform. Claude Code provides a range of features to support deployment, including automatic deployment, continuous integration, and continuous deployment. You can use the built-in deployment tools to deploy your project to popular hosting platforms like AWS, Google Cloud, or Microsoft Azure.

When deploying your project, Claude Code provides a range of features that enhance productivity and efficiency. These include automatic testing, code optimization, and performance monitoring. Additionally, you can use the built-in analytics tools to track user engagement, track user behavior, and gain insights into your project's performance.

One of the key benefits of Claude Code's deployment feature is its ability to automate the deployment process. You can use the built-in deployment tools to deploy your project to a hosting platform, eliminating the need for manual intervention and reducing the risk of errors.

Advanced Workflow Patterns

Claude Code provides a range of advanced workflow patterns that enable developers to streamline their workflow, boost productivity, and deliver higher-quality projects. These include automated testing, continuous integration, and continuous deployment, as well as real-time collaboration and code review.

When using advanced workflow patterns, Claude Code provides a range of features that enhance productivity and efficiency. These include automated testing, code optimization, and performance monitoring. Additionally, you can use the built-in analytics tools to track user engagement, track user behavior, and gain insights into your project's performance.

One of the key benefits of Claude Code's advanced workflow patterns is its ability to automate repetitive tasks. You can use the built-in automation tools to automate testing, deployment, and other tasks, reducing the risk of errors and increasing productivity.

Frequently Asked Questions

What is Claude Code, and how does it work?

Claude Code is a cloud-based development platform that enables developers to create, deploy, and manage web applications quickly and efficiently. It provides a range of features, including multi-file editing, debugging, testing, and deployment, as well as real-time collaboration and code review. Claude Code uses AI-powered tools to automate repetitive tasks, identify errors, and optimize code, reducing the risk of errors and increasing productivity.

Is Claude Code compatible with popular frameworks like React and Angular?

Yes, Claude Code is compatible with popular frameworks like React and Angular. You can use the built-in project templates to create new projects, or import existing projects and configure the necessary dependencies and settings. Claude Code also provides a range of features that enhance productivity and collaboration, including live previews, code suggestions, and real-time feedback.

Can I use Claude Code for large-scale projects?

Yes, Claude Code is designed to handle large-scale projects with ease. You can create, edit, and manage multiple files within a single project, using the built-in code editor or integrating your preferred IDE. Claude Code also supports real-time collaboration, enabling multiple developers to work on the same project simultaneously. This feature is particularly useful for distributed teams or projects with multiple stakeholders.

Is Claude Code secure, and does it comply with industry standards?

Yes, Claude Code is designed to be secure and compliant with industry standards. It uses advanced encryption and authentication protocols to protect user data and prevent unauthorized access. Claude Code also complies with industry standards, including GDPR and HIPAA, ensuring that your project meets the highest standards of security and reliability.

What is the pricing model for Claude Code?

Claude Code offers a range of pricing plans to suit different needs and budgets. You can choose from a free plan, a basic plan, or an enterprise plan, depending on your project requirements. The pricing plans include features like multi-file editing, debugging, testing, and deployment, as well as real-time collaboration and code review.

Does Claude Code provide customer support?

Yes, Claude Code provides customer support through multiple channels, including email, phone, and live chat. You can also access the built-in documentation and knowledge base to find answers to common questions and troubleshoot issues.

Share your love
Alex Clearfield
Alex Clearfield

Alex Clearfield reports on AI industry news, product launches, and technology trends for Clear AI News. With a commitment to factual reporting, Alex provides balanced coverage of the rapidly evolving artificial intelligence landscape.

Articles: 141

Stay informed and not overwhelmed, subscribe now!

Featured on
Listed on DevTool.ioListed on SaaSHubFeatured on FoundrList